Hi. I post a quick video where i play this game with Oculus Rift. All you need to have is OR and buy vorpx drivers from vorpx.com and thats pretty much it.
http://www.youtube.com/watch?v=3trAXTHXpZg&feature=youtu.be
The only thing that must be solved is the low field of view (currently 75). In order to have a true perspective you must have 120 fov. I managed to change it in freecamera mode but cannot find a working solution for captains view. See thread here . http://www.subsim.com/radioroom/showthread.php?t=208057
Other than that its pretty much as perfect as it gets with game that was not designed for rift.
